WebApr 7, 2024 · Solubility data can therefore be used to choose an appropriate solvent for an extraction. For example, imagine that caffeine (Figure 4.12) is intended to be extracted … Webleaves into hot water. [The solubility of caffeine in water is 22 mg/ml at 25oC, 180 mg/ml at 80oC, and 670 mg/ml at 100oC.] The hot solution is allowed to cool and the caffeine is …

WebIt is used as an extraction solvent for spice oleoresins, hops, and for the removal of caffeine from coffee. However, due to concern over residual solvent, most decaffeinators no longer use methylene chloride. ... Methylene chloride is a colorless liquid with a sweetish odor. WebDec 30, 2013 · Standard solutions that are used for extraction are: 5 % hydrochloric acid, 5 % sodium hydroxide solution, saturated sodium bicarbonate solution (~6 %) and water. All of these solutions help to modify the (organic) compound and make it more water-soluble and therefore remove it from the organic layer. More concentrated solutions are rarely used ...
